A discussion essay presents and discusses issues surrounding a particular topic--usually one that is debatable and open to argument. A good discussion essay must include a thorough discussion of both sides of the topic. It should provide a well-rounded understanding of the issues before the writer presents his personal opinions and conclusions.

Your Discussion and Conclusions sections should answer the question: What do your results mean? In other words, the majority of the Discussion and Conclusions sections should be an interpretation of your results. Discuss your conclusions in order of most to least important. Compare your results with those from other studies: Are they consistent?

Conclusion. Your conclusion should sum up how your essay has answered the title. It should reinforce your introduction and include a reference to the wording of the title. If your essay has presented evidence or data, ensure that the conclusions you draw are valid in the light of that evidence and data.
